Travelling from Spondon to Alsager by Train

Embark on a train journey from Spondon to Alsager, and you'll find it's quicker than you might anticipate!

The typical travel time is about 2hrs 25 mins, but if you're in a hurry or just eager to arrive, the fastest trains can whisk you there in just 1hrs 20 mins. With approximately 15 trains running daily, you have a wealth of options to choose from. This scenic route, spanning 39 miles (62 km), generally involves just one transfer, and operators like East Midlands Railway, West Midlands Trains, CrossCountry offer comfortable seating with plenty of room for your luggage.

Here's the best part: by booking your tickets in advance, you can snag fares starting from only £3.20, offering a substantial saving over buying tickets at the last minute. For even more savings, consider traveling during Off-Peak times or using a Railcard.

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Spondon to Alsager start from as little as £3.20

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Spondon to Alsager start from £14.40 one way, or £14.50 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Spondon to Alsager are available for £18.90 one way, or £21.00 return

Spondon Station at a Glance

Spondon Station might surprise visitors with its simplicity. Do note that there is no staffed ticket office or ticket machines available here, so purchasing tickets in advance online is a must-do. However, the station does take into account the need for basic accessibility with level ramped access to platforms, and tactile paving in place.

While amenities like toilets and refreshment facilities are absent, you'll find CCTV installed, ensuring safety around the clock. If you're someone relying on technology to stay connected, do adjust your expectations as there is no public Wi-Fi, but this can often be a perfect excuse to unplug and enjoy a moment of quiet reflection before your journey. For those who cycle, there are a few spaces available for bicycle storage.

Onward Travel from Spondon

Venturing beyond Spondon station itself is easy with a bus stop conveniently located adjacent to the level crossing near the station entrance. This provides a seamless connection for further travels or simply getting around locally. If you want specific onward travel plans, you can find detailed information and printable maps here. Rail replacement services also pick up from the same location when needed.

Station Facilities at Alsager

Alsager Train Station is without a ticket office, but fear not, for ticket machines are conveniently placed for ease of ticket purchase. It's important to note that while you can purchase tickets directly from the machines, the station does not support the collection of pre-purchased online tickets. Accessibility options include step-free access in certain areas and ramps for train boarding, ensuring that it accommodates passengers with mobility needs.

The station offers basic amenities: seating areas are available for awaiting passengers, and an induction loop facilitates those with hearing impairments. However, facilities such as waiting rooms, accessible toilets, and refreshment outlets are absent. Sustainability-minded visitors will find ample bicycle storage, albeit without shelter, but fitted with CCTV for increased security.

Travel Connections and Onward Journey

Alsager station provides several transport links, making onward travel straightforward. A bus stop right outside the station entrance integrates seamlessly with northbound and southbound services, facilitating a smooth transition for passengers needing to connect beyond the immediate rail service. Additionally, information for planning further journeys is accessible online, with a convenient printable format available here.
